8. And with the blast of Your nostrilsThe waters were gathered together;The floods stood upright like a heap;The depths congealed in the heart of the sea.
9. The enemy said, ‘I will pursue,I will overtake,I will divide the spoil;My desire shall be satisfied on them.I will draw my sword,My hand shall destroy them.’
10. You blew with Your wind,The sea covered them;They sank like lead in the mighty waters.
11. “Who is like You, O Lord, among the gods?Who is like You, glorious in holiness,Fearful in praises, doing wonders?
12. You stretched out Your right hand;The earth swallowed them.
13. You in Your mercy have led forthThe people whom You have redeemed;You have guided them in Your strengthTo Your holy habitation.
14. “The people will hear and be afraid;Sorrow will take hold of the inhabitants of Philistia.
15. Then the chiefs of Edom will be dismayed;The mighty men of Moab,Trembling will take hold of them;All the inhabitants of Canaan will melt away.
16. Fear and dread will fall on them;By the greatness of Your armThey will be as still as a stone,Till Your people pass over, O Lord,Till the people pass overWhom You have purchased.
17. You will bring them in and plant themIn the mountain of Your inheritance,In the place, O Lord, which You have madeFor Your own dwelling,The sanctuary, O Lord, which Your hands have established.
18. “The Lord shall reign forever and ever.”
